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$2,081 per month in Fritzlar vs $1,447 in Mexico City, rent included.

A couple spends around $3,127 per month in Fritzlar vs $2,310 in Mexico City, rent included.

A family of three spends $4,172 per month in Fritzlar vs $3,174 in Mexico City, rent included.

Fritzlar costs about 44% more than Mexico City, driven mainly by Eating Out.

Both Fritzlar and Mexico City sit above the global median – Fritzlar by 55%, Mexico City by 8%.

Cost Breakdown

A central one-bedroom costs $843 in Fritzlar versus $995 in Mexico City.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.

A mid-range dinner for two costs $57.0 in Fritzlar versus $53.0 in Mexico City.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$355 vs $288 – making Mexico City the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
